Dighmistskali River
The Dighmistskali is a right tributary of the Mtkvari (Kura) River, located primarily within the municipality of Tbilisi. It originates on the eastern slopes of the Trialeti Range and flows through the Dighomi valley, a rapidly developing residential and commercial area of the capital. Historically, the river played a role in local agriculture, but today its lower reaches are heavily urbanized. The Dighmistskali valley is known for its relatively milder microclimate compared to other parts of Tbilisi. While the river itself is small and often shallow, its gorge offers some green spaces and walking paths for local residents, providing a brief escape from the urban environment.
